Job Role
The Head of Financial Planning & Analysis (FP&A) is a corporate finance leadership role responsible for governing financial planning, budgeting, forecasting, management reporting, and financial data consolidation across the organization's Indonesian operations.
The position will oversee the development and standardization of financial planning frameworks across multiple business units, manufacturing facilities, supply chain operations, and commercial channels. The role will also provide financial insights to senior management to support strategic decisions related to cost optimization, business expansion, capital investment, manufacturing capacity, and commercial growth.
This role requires a senior, hands-on FP&A professional with strong analytical capabilities, advanced financial modeling skills, and the ability to translate complex operational and financial data into clear insights for senior leadership.

Key Responsibilities
- Lead and govern the annual operating plan (AOP), annual budgeting process, long-term financial planning, and rolling forecasts across multiple operating units.
- Develop and maintain financial models to support business planning, forecasting, scenario analysis, and strategic decision-making.
- Establish standardized data structures, financial logic, and consolidation methodologies across multiple business units and operating entities.
- Consolidate financial and operational data from manufacturing facilities, supply chain operations, logistics, and commercial channels into accurate management reports.
- Prepare monthly management reporting packages, management discussion and analysis (MD&A), financial dashboards, and executive reports for senior leadership.
- Conduct detailed budget-versus-actual analysis and identify key financial and operational variances.
- Monitor OpEx, CapEx, raw material costs, manufacturing costs, logistics expenses, and other major cost drivers against approved budgets and forecasts.
- Develop cost-control initiatives and provide financial recommendations to improve operational efficiency and profitability.
- Coordinate financial planning and reporting requirements with regional and global business units and corporate headquarters.
- Ensure consistency of financial reporting standards, planning methodologies, and performance indicators across business units.
- Conduct financial modeling, sensitivity analysis, ROI analysis, and scenario planning for major investments and strategic initiatives.
- Support financial evaluation of factory expansion, production capacity increases, new production lines, cold-chain infrastructure, and other capital investments.
- Provide financial insights and recommendations to senior management to support strategic business decisions and capital allocation.
- Lead, mentor, and develop the FP&A team, including one Supervisor and two Staff members.
- Establish strong data verification, reporting accuracy, and financial governance processes within the FP&A function.
- Partner with Accounting, Tax, Treasury, Transformation, Commercial Finance, Operations, and Supply Chain teams to ensure accurate and timely financial information.
- Monitor financial performance against strategic and operational targets and highlight key risks and opportunities to management.
- Prepare financial forecasts, business performance analysis, and strategic recommendations for senior leadership and regional/global stakeholders.
